• Moving work by the important representative of German Informalism.
• In 1959, 1964 and 1977 he participated in documenta II, III and 6 in Kassel.
• From the same year of creation as the important documenta picture “For Berlin”.
• In 1958, Schumacher's works were shown in the German pavilion at the Venice Biennale.
• Other works from the 1950s are now part of important museum collections like the Metropolitan Museum of Art in New York, the Hamburger Kunsthalle and the Kunsthalle Karlsruhe.
